Radiator Replacement and Maintenance for the 2012 Volkswagen Amarok

The 2012 Volkswagen Amarok is a robust and reliable utility vehicle designed to meet the demands of both urban and off-road driving. A key component of its cooling system is the radiator, which plays a crucial role in maintaining the engine's optimal operating temperature. Ensuring your radiator is in top-notch condition is essential for the longevity and performance of your vehicle.

Radiator maintenance is an often-overlooked aspect of vehicle servicing, but it can make a world of difference in preventing engine overheating and extending the life of your engine. Here are a few things to keep in mind when servicing or replacing your Amarok's radiator:

  1. Regular Checks and Cleaning: Make it a habit to regularly check your radiator for any signs of damage, corrosion, or leaks. Radiators can become clogged with debris and dirt over time, which reduces their efficiency. Gently clean the radiator's exterior with a soft brush and water to keep these elements from obstructing airflow.
  2. Coolant Level and Quality: One of the most important aspects of radiator maintenance is keeping the coolant at the appropriate level and ensuring it is in good condition. Over time, coolant can degrade and lose its effectiveness. It is advisable to flush and replace the coolant in accordance with the vehicle manufacturer's guidelines. Use only the type and mixture recommended by Volkswagen to avoid any potential damage.
  3. Inspecting Hoses and Connections: The radiator hoses play a vital role in the cooling system's performance. During maintenance, inspect these hoses for any signs of wear or leaks. Replace them if you notice any soft spots, cracks, or other damage. Additionally, ensure that all the connections are secure and free from leaks.

If you find yourself needing to replace the radiator, it is also a good opportunity to inspect other cooling system components like the thermostat and water pump. This will ensure that the entire system operates efficiently and reduces the risk of future issues.

Fitting a new radiator should ideally be performed by a professional mechanic to guarantee that it is installed correctly and your coolant is topped up to the appropriate level. However, if you are a keen DIY enthusiast with the right tools and level of confidence, you could undertake this task yourself by following detailed instructions and ensuring all safety measures are observed. Whichever path you choose, addressing radiator issues sooner rather than later can prevent more costly engine repairs down the road.
